]> granicus.if.org Git - curl/commitdiff
gtls: avoid uninitialized variable.
authorDaniel Stenberg <daniel@haxx.se>
Sat, 21 Mar 2015 15:44:17 +0000 (16:44 +0100)
committerDaniel Stenberg <daniel@haxx.se>
Sat, 21 Mar 2015 15:53:09 +0000 (16:53 +0100)
Coverity CID 1291166 pointed out that we could read this variable
uninitialized.

lib/vtls/gtls.c

index 53412a1a255c63beaee8b9e3c8756abf54bcd04e..d6293e50600af33ed32d199609a088e8779d1608 100644 (file)
@@ -779,7 +779,7 @@ gtls_connect_step3(struct connectdata *conn,
 {
   unsigned int cert_list_size;
   const gnutls_datum_t *chainp;
-  unsigned int verify_status;
+  unsigned int verify_status = 0;
   gnutls_x509_crt_t x509_cert, x509_issuer;
   gnutls_datum_t issuerp;
   char certbuf[256] = ""; /* big enough? */